You'll Need:

-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 tbsp thyme
- 1 tbsp rosemary
- 1 tbsp chili powder
- 2 tbsp oregano
- 2 tbsp paprika
- salt & pepper to taste

Extra:

- 10 oz spaghetti noodles
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 onion, diced
- 1 green pepper, chopped
- 1 yellow pepper, chopped
- 10 fl oz red wine
- 20 oz tomato sauce
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 8 oz shredded mozzarella

Here's How:

1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Season the ground beef with thyme, rosemary, chili powder, oregano, paprika, salt, and pepper and mix well.

2. Divide the ground beef mixture and spaghetti noodles into 4 portions. Form the ground beef around the middle of the uncooked spaghetti noodles, making sure to leave some of the noodles hanging out on either side. Repeat this 3 more times with the rest of the meat and noodles.

3. Heat some olive oil in a large casserole dish, place the meatball-wrapped spaghetti portions inside, and cook the meat. Add the onions, garlic, and peppers and let cook before reducing everything with red wine. Pour tomato sauce over everything, s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ese on top, put the casserole dish in the oven, and cook for 30 minutes.

You'll love this fast and tasty dish that can be prepared lickety-split at the end of a long day. Feel free to mix up the vegetables or add to the dish, like with zucchini and carrots — the possibilities are endless!
